How can you make a electromagnet stronger?

Adding to electromagnets

  1. Increasing the number of coils (or turns) of wire.
  2. Increasing the electric current through the coil.
  3. Placing a magnetic material inside the solenoid coil.

How can you increase the strength of an electromagnet?

You can make an electromagnet stronger by doing these things:

  1. wrapping the coil around a piece of iron (such as an iron nail)
  2. adding more turns to the coil.
  3. increasing the current flowing through the coil.

What variables can you manipulate to improve the strength of the electromagnet?

Factors that affect the strength of electromagnets are the nature of the core material, strength of the current passing through the core, the number of turns of wire on the core and the shape and size of the core.

What must you have for an electromagnet to work that you don’t need for a regular magnet?

The main advantage of an electromagnet over a permanent magnet is that the magnetic field can be quickly changed by controlling the amount of electric current in the winding. However, unlike a permanent magnet that needs no power, an electromagnet requires a continuous supply of current to maintain the magnetic field.

Do electromagnets weaken over time?

The iron becomes magnetised. A horseshoe magnet is made this way, but the ever-reliable second law of thermodynamics assures us that over time, at any temperature above absolute zero, atoms will move around and randomise their positions. So any magnet will slowly weaken over time.

Do electromagnets lose strength?

This alignment is damaged over time, principally as the result of heat and stray electromagnetic fields, and this weakens the level of magnetism. The process is very slow, however: a modern samarium-cobalt magnet takes around 700 years to lose half its strength.

Why do motors spin?

Inside an electric motor, permanent magnets are set onto a ring surrounding a coil of wire. When the appliance’s switch is flicked on, electrons flow through the wire, turning it into an electromagnet. The attractive and repulsive forces of the permanent magnets around it make the electromagnet spin.

What metal makes the best electromagnet?

soft iron
For an electromagnet, the best option available currently is soft iron or one of its variants. The champion is cobalt iron, available commercially under the name VACOFLUX. Ferrites are less suitable because they saturate at lower flux density. Neodymium is not an option at all, because it is used in permanent magnets.

What gauge wire is best for electromagnet?

  • The most efficient and cost effective metal is copper.
  • Since the strength is proportional to ampere-turns, you can use many turns of small gauge wire at low current, or fewer turns at higher current.
  • The most efficient electromagnets actually use superconducting wire.
